Agile Specialist: Bridging the Gap Between Business and Technology

In today's fast-paced business environment, it is crucial to have a strong link between the business strategy and the technology that implements them. This is where the task of an Agile BA comes in. An Agile BA acts as a catalyst, explaining complex business requirements into understandable user stories that developers can execute.

By cultivating collaboration between the business and IT teams, Agile BAs help to ensure that projects are delivered on time, within budget, and that they indeed meet the needs of the users.

  • Important Roles of an Agile BA include:
  • Carrying out business requirement gathering and analysis.
  • Documenting user stories and acceptance criteria.
  • Working with stakeholders to determine product backlog items.
  • Guiding sprint planning, daily stand-ups, and retrospectives.
